How does one determine the file system a disk uses, for disks that are
not yet mounted? Example: You're handed a disk that has been sitting
around in a closet for years, with no idea what it was used for. The
department manager tells you to see what it contains.
How do I mount it, if I don't already know what file system it uses?
Is there a command to query this? Trial and error doesn't seem like
the ideal solution.
